Etymology edit

From Proto-Indo-European *domu-, from *dṓm (house) + տէր (tēr, lord). See տուն (tun) for more.

Noun edit

տանուտէր (tanutēr)

  1. master of a house, head of a family
  2. landlord, householder
  3. patriarch, chief of a tribe or race
  4. (astrology) the sign of the zodiac which houses the Sun in the current month
    տանուտէր տարւոյtanutēr tarwoythe Sun's house
